I just want to know if I can connect my laptop to my Samsung HT-Q70 Home Theater System for audio so I can hear the sound from the laptop on my Home Theater speakers?

Yes you can and it is very simple. All you need is a special wire. One end fits to the earphone jack on the laptop, and the other end looks like rca cable. At the back of your home theater choose aux in, and connect the rca end of the cable to that. Then the other end looks like a headphone jack, and you connect that to the laptop headphone jack. Now on you home theater select aux. You will everything that comeout of that laptop including the windows vista melody when you first boot it up. Now you are ready to enjoy music.

When a movie is playing, you can hear all sounds except the actors voices....they are mumbled.

The voices are probably coming out on one of the channels that has a bad speaker, bad wire, loose connector, or bad output. If you have the audio set to 5.1 output, change it to two-channel stereo output. The voices should return to normal.

Compatibility fo TV and Sound system

TV has audio outputs, the RCA cable type. If you connect the audio output (red,white) from the TV(look on the back), and connect the RCA cable to Input of home theater system,you should get TV sound from home theater system. You may have to set the audio on the TV for external source. Go to menu, to audio setup, to options. On the Home Theater system, you may have to select the audio source, i.e. audio input 1, etc.

How do i connect/play my turntable?

Hi sorry to say cant go direct.

What you can do if really want it running is get a RIAA pre amp with power supply (search google local shops). The turn table plugs into that, then that plugs into one of the analogue inputs of the Q70. That will work great if prepared for the effort!

Swa3000

  1. With the home theater system off, press and hold the REMAIN button on the home theater's remote control for 5 seconds.
    Note: You can release the REMAIN button when the POWER LED blinks blue/Red depending on model.
  2. With the SWA-3000 turned on, use a ball point pen to press the RESET button on the back of the SWA-3000. The POWER LED in the front of the home theater blinks two times.
